It's ubiquitous throughout North India. In every city, every city, there are dozens of restaurants serving succulent items of tender rooster grilled to perfection in clay ovens or 'tandoors.' This dish is to India what vodka is to Russians and hamburgers to Americans.The distinctive taste of Hen Tikka Masala could be attributed significantly to the tandoor through which it is cooked. This cylindrical clay oven, which is typically about 3-four ft high, imparts its personal taste to the meat. The warmth is provided via coal or charcoal burnt on the bottom. The meat is skewered by and positioned in the oven for about 7-10 minutes. It is normally served with a spicy mint and yogurt 'chutney', onions, and a thin bread called 'romali roti.'By way of spices, it incorporates all of the spices typical to Indian cuisine: red pepper, cumin, dried coriander, turmeric, and 'garam masala'. Just add some cumin flavored potatoes and you might be able to go!Typically even skilled cooks can get confused between garam masala vs curry powder. In any case, both are used in Indian cooking and so they appear to be a staple ingredient in many dishes. How totally different may the components be, in any case?You might be surprised to be taught that they are actually very completely different spices, comprising different ingredients. As a matter of reality, curry powder is just not even popularly utilized in Indian kitchens. It was initially a British concoction to offer an Indian taste to their foods. Different blends will add bay leaves, coriander seeds, cumin seeds, star anise, fennel seeds, poppy seeds, sesame seeds and regional variants might have other spices like mustard and fenugreek seeds added to the blend. Curry powder often has some spices like cardamom, cinnamon, clove, coriander, cumin, in smaller portions, but additionally comprises turmeric, ginger, fenugreek seeds, crimson chilli, asafetida, ginger, garlic, mustard seeds. It can be in several warmth variants, delicate, medium or hot. Each spice blends will use quite a lot of substances, relying on the formulation used to make the mix and the region it's from. Usage - due to its heat and pungent spices, is used at the finish of the cooking process. It may be incorporated in the meals, and even sprinkled on it, very like a garnish. The heat of the food releases the important oils within the spices and provides a kick to the food. Alternatively, curry powder is added originally of the cooking course of as many components like turmeric and mustard have to be cooked. Coloration - garam masala is typically a shade of brown, whereas curry powder is normally yellowish in color. Dishes - curry powder shouldn't be generally used in India besides maybe in 'British Indian' dishes, however is suitable in different countries. Generally, it may be the only spice used other than salt. Garam masala is extensively used in India in lots of dishes, with other spices to give taste and warmth to the foods. It's hardly ever used alone. Garam masala and curry powder, depending on the model you employ (or in case you make your individual), have diverse flavor profiles and are best not used interchangeably because the taste of the meals will probably be very different.
